With over 18 million students across 175 countries, ReadTheory’s online learning platform is improving reading comprehension for students around the globe. Designed by an English Teacher in North Carolina, ReadTheory came from humble beginnings. The company has organically grown by word-of-mouth without any advertising, and has been quietly taking market-share from some of edtech’s biggest giants.

“ReadTheory’s superpower is that it recognizes there is no one-size-fits-all classroom. The platform’s A.I identifies each student’s strengths and weaknesses and serves adaptive reading practice at the ‘just right’ level. It’s personalized, and that’s why it has such a significant impact,” says Josh Capon, Co-Managing Partner of ReadTheory.

The program is aligned to ELA standards and supports teachers with real-time reporting that helps them know what to teach next. The school and district program will centralize efforts across the school  community, seamlessly integrate with Learning Management Systems, and offer deeper student performance data. School and District administrators can learn more about ReadTheory and request an introduction here

As Mrs. Kara Guiff, an Indiana educator put it, “ReadTheory finds the appropriate leveled texts and comprehension questions and students learn by tracking their data and setting goals. It’s the best comprehension intervention program I’ve used in over 30 years of teaching. I’ve been known to say I won’t even teach ELA without it.”

While ReadTheory has a free subscription available to teachers, its premium subscription has grown over 300% in the last year. Of teachers surveyed, 80% say ReadTheory positively impacts standardized test scores, and school and district leaders are starting to take notice. On top of increasing achievement, 89% of teachers say ReadTheory also keeps students engaged and interested when on the platform.
